About LEIGH AND BRANSFORD MEMORIAL HALL AND RECREATION GROUND
LEIGH AND BRANSFORD MEMORIAL HALL AND RECREATION GROUND is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 523163), rated "Platinum" with a CharityScore of 90/100 — one of the highest-rated charities in England and Wales based on official Charity Commission data. In its most recent reporting year (2025), LEIGH AND BRANSFORD MEMORIAL HALL AND RECREATION GROUND reported a total income of £27,880 and total expenditure of £24,583 (a spending ratio of 88%, indicating strong allocation of funds to charitable activities). According to the Charity Commission, LEIGH AND BRANSFORD MEMORIAL HALL AND RECREATION GROUND operates with the following stated purpose: Providing and maintaining two halls and a playing field for the benefit of local organisations. No significant governance concerns were identified for LEIGH AND BRANSFORD MEMORIAL HALL AND RECREATION GROUND in our analysis.
